9wishes labels the product SPF21, but no PA rating was verified on the current official product page. Use a separate broad-spectrum sunscreen on exposed body areas.
It is an immediate cosmetic brightening or evening effect, not proof of long-term pigment treatment.
It is sold as a body serum. Choose a face-specific product for facial use.
The brand describes reduced concern about transfer, but it is not confirmed as transfer-proof. Apply thinly and let it set before dressing.
Apply a thin tone-up layer, let it settle, then apply a dedicated broad-spectrum body sunscreen according to that sunscreen's directions.
